Competitions for men at the table:

  • "Toast". We give everyone a bottle, ask them to open it in an unusual way and proclaim an original toast, for example: “Drink beer - you will be strong and beautiful!”, “Drink foamy beer - you will have an excellent life!”;
  • "Piglets". Prepare a dish like “jelly” or “jellied meat” and challenge the participants to eat it with matches, toothpicks or chopsticks. The one who does it the fastest wins;
  • "Splash Screen". Two teams are participating. One comes up with a screensaver for the computer desktop, depicts it using gestures, and the other tries to guess;
  • "Web". Two teams play, each with an administrator. Participants stand in two circles and hold hands, and then get confused. The administrator's task is to untangle the opposing team without touching the participants with their hands. Whoever does it faster wins;
  • "Rings". Attach a shield to the wall with long nails driven in at a short distance from each other. Hang prizes on nails in small bags. Participants try to throw rings on nails; those who succeed take away prizes. The one who is lucky enough to receive the most prizes wins.

What are the names of shoulder insignia in the Russian army and navy? (Epaulette and epaulette). 14. The word “soldier” and the name of the coin. What do they have in common? (The word “soldier” owes its origin to the coin. The money that Roman soldiers received for their service was called “solidarius.” The word spread to other countries and became “soldier”). 15. What is common between the unit of the Russian banknote “kopek” and the spear of the warrior St. George? (The unit of Russian monetary account, minted by order of Elena Glinskaya, the mother of Ivan the Terrible, received the name “kopek”, as it had an image of the spearman St. George slaying a dragon with a spear). 16. Loud reader competition
Props: any newspapers, men participate :)
The presenter announces that the participants must demonstrate how they read newspapers out loud at home for the whole family, and the one who does it best and loudest will win. To do this, they sit in armchairs or on chairs, roll up one trouser leg to the knee (so that their bare leg is visible), cross their legs (bare leg, naturally, on top) and are given a newspaper in their hands. Reading texts should be as diverse as possible. At the command of the presenter, the participants begin to read newspapers out loud, trying to talk down their opponents. Such a funny hubbub begins that the spectators are rolling with laughter... At the command “stop,” the reading stops, and the presenter announces the winner. The last joke: the presenter announces that in fact this competition was not for reading, but for the hairiest legs, and the prize goes to the “hairiest” one. :)))))))

Rhinoceroses
Props: balloons (1 for each), regular thread, adhesive plaster, pushpin (1 for each)
Number of people - the more, the better. The game can be either a team game or every man for himself.
The balloon is inflated and tied with a thread around the waist (the balloon should be at the level and area of ​​the buttocks). The button is used to pierce a piece of adhesive tape and stick it on the player’s forehead. This procedure is done with each participant. Then each player must fold his hands on his chest or behind his back (he cannot use them during the game), or he can tie them. After all these preparations, the start is given (a certain amount of time is set - for a team game, after the time has elapsed, whoever survived is counted; and for the game, every man for himself - the game is played to the last), after which the player’s task is to pierce the enemy’s ball with a button on the forehead (not using your hands). It all looks simply amazing, the main thing is that there are more people. Well, the winner gets an incentive prize.

Understand me!!!
The participants of the game (at least 4 people) are divided into two teams. A “driving” team is appointed. The other team comes up with a word without being heard by the opposing players. This word is communicated “in the ear” of one of the representatives of the “driving” team. The goal of this participant in the game is to depict with gestures the meaning of the word communicated to him so that his team names the hidden word. Using letters, pronouncing this word with your lips without a voice (and, of course, with your voice), and also pointing at an object called this word is prohibited. If the team guesses the word, it gets a point. Next, the teams switch places. In the next round, other representatives from the teams must speak, and so on until everyone has spoken. Of course, this game may not seem very funny, but if you give free rein to your imagination, you can come up with very “interesting” words: “vacuum cleaner”, “orgasm”, etc. In addition, of course, the players are required to be relaxed and have a light, humorous attitude towards fun.

Spiritualism session
Props: plate, coin, candle
The leading toastmaster asks a person who believes in spiritualism, calling the spirit, etc. to take part in the game. After that, they sit down at the table opposite each other. There are 2 plates on the table near the host and the player. There is a coin in the host’s plate. The host says that if the player is very attentive and focused, looks only into the host’s eyes and absolutely exactly repeats his movements, then the coin will move to the player’s plate. The lights in the room go out, a candle is lit in the middle of the table, and there is deathly silence. The presenter makes various magical passes with his hands, from time to time running his open palm along the bottom of his plate, and then over his face. This continues for several minutes, and then the presenter says that unfortunately today the trick failed. The joke of the competition is that the bottom of the player's plate was previously smoked using a candle/match/lighter, and every time the player runs his palm over the bottom and then over his face, it becomes blacker and blacker. The most important thing is that the audience, seeing all this before the end of the game, does not laugh too loudly.
